Transaction 152beda57d78f7915b991219dd4c6b65ec32769db7a6fdadf205c03673293e4e

1 Input
2 Outputs
  • 152beda57d78f7915b991219dd4c6b65ec32769db7a6fdadf205c03673293e4e:0
  • value  96877540
    address  12iHa6U2TTHK1z1RUq9Sgz89Ei3VfVMvFE
  • 152beda57d78f7915b991219dd4c6b65ec32769db7a6fdadf205c03673293e4e:1
  • value  570236
    address  15TVFwSNtDxWYb4CNdiXPNu6sT5no4uSY2